Navision Time is a crucial aspect of using Microsoft Dynamics NAV, now known as Dynamics 365 Business Central. Navigating through Navision Time effectively is vital for maximizing productivity and efficiency in your business processes.
One of the key features of Navision Time is its user-friendly interface that allows for easy navigation. Users can quickly access different modules and functions within the system to input and track time-related data.
When navigating through Navision Time, it is important to familiarize yourself with the various modules and functionalities available. These may include time entry, time tracking, reporting, and analysis tools. By understanding how to navigate through these features, users can streamline their time management processes and make informed decisions based on accurate data.
Time entry is a fundamental aspect of Navision Time, allowing users to input their time spent on various tasks or projects. By navigating through the time entry module, users can easily log their hours, assign them to specific projects or clients, and categorize them based on different criteria.
Another essential feature of Navision Time is the time tracking functionality. This allows users to monitor and track their time in real-time, enabling them to stay on top of their schedules and deadlines. By navigating through the time tracking module, users can see a detailed overview of their time usage and make adjustments as needed to optimize their productivity.
Reporting and analysis tools within Navision Time provide valuable insights into time-related data. By navigating through these tools, users can generate reports on time spent, analyze trends, and identify areas for improvement. This data-driven approach allows businesses to make informed decisions and enhance their overall efficiency.
